WHAT DOES CARTLAND M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Cartland

Cartland may refer to: ▪ Barbara Cartland, DBE, CStJ,, successful English author, known for her numerous romance novels ▪ George Cartland, CMG, the only deputy-governor of Uganda and later the Vice-Chancellor of the University of Tasmania ▪ Michael David Cartland, the Secretary for Financial Services of Hong Kong during British rule in the 1990s ▪ Moses Austin Cartland, Quaker abolitionist ▪ Ronald Cartland, British Conservative Member of Parliament from 1935 until he was killed in action in 1940...

Definition of Cartland in the English dictionary

The definition of Cartland in the dictionary is Dame Barbara. 1901–2000, British novelist, noted for her prolific output of popular romantic fiction.
